Troy is no ordinary Chardonnay. Rather, it is the archetype of a Chardonnay, as Wolfgang Klotz, managing director of probably the most successful winegrowers' cooperative in South Tyrol, sees it. The grapes come from two selected vineyards in Söll, near Tramin. Not only does a Mediterranean climate prevail there, but also quite cold fall winds at night determine the vegetation. Both factors ensure optimal development of the plants and fruits. The berries are handpicked piece by piece and it is therefore clear to every wine connoisseur that this is an absolutely prestigious project of the cooperative. It is therefore not surprising that only 3,000 bottles of this vintage are sold in selected specialist shops and top restaurants.

Querciabella's Riserva, with an annual production of 10,000 bottles, is a selection of the best lots. It blends fruit from Greve, where the vineyards lie between 350 and 550 metres above sea level, with grapes from the stony high altitudes of Radda and the chalky soils of Gaiole. With the exception of 2016 and 2019, the last eight years in the region around Montalcino have been characterised by warm and dry conditions. For this reason, Il Poggione has started to prioritise irrigation for emergencies (which is becoming more and more of a necessity in the south-west of Montalcino) and is looking for a better balance in the higher vineyards. This is not the only reason why Il Poggione is one of the top producers every year, with an extremely fair value.
Oenologist Alessandro Bindocci compares the 2019 and 2016 vintages as follows "Both Brunellos are quite classic, but the 2019 has more energy and fruit than the 2016 at the same stage."

In the vast universe of Italian wine, we can name few red wines that inspire as much fascination, even awe, as those of Josko Gravner. And so Rosso Breg cannot be missing from our list of Italy's greatest red wines. Today's 2007 fermented for more than a year on the skins in wooden barrels, then in underground amphorae, after which it matured for five years in barrel and five more in bottle before being released. And yet it is the youngest red wine ever released from Josko's cellar!

"The very first single-vineyard Barolo produced by the family, first made in 1985, this is vinified in stainless steel tanks with moderate temperature control. It then undergoes maceration for 30 days and ageing in botti for about 30 months, with a small portion of the wine in French oak barriques for the first 12 months. The owner and winemaker Alessandro Mori describes himself as a "naturalista". His wines ferment spontaneously with autochthonous grape varieties and age for a long time in large old oak barrels. He lets the natural temperatures of the cellar control the refinement of the wine and uses minimal sulphur throughout. The small, 80-year-old vineyard of Pietrabona on the island of Giglio produces an Ansonica of outstanding quality, and so Bibi Graetz decided to vinify the grapes separately in small batches. The vines stand on a bed of rocks and granite sand less than 50 metres from the sea, resulting in a wine with a subtle aroma of ripe oranges, fine spice, flint and minerality. SUPERIORE.DE

Actually, the single vineyard of just 1 hectare is unique, as it only comprises a small hilltop in the shape of a fan (Italian: ventaglio). The grapes from here have always represented the top of the winery's production and so it was decided to vinify them separately from the 2015 vintage onwards - and the new top wine "Ventaglio" was born.
Due to the curious location and geographical orientation of the vineyard in all directions, there are morning grapes, midday grapes and evening grapes here and they represent the respective site-specific microclimate in an impressive way. Likewise, through the subsequent joint processing, they give their differences in aromatic development, maturity and freshness as a total work of art in this exceptional wine, in which every nuance of the terroir, no matter how small, is expressed correctly and in a balanced manner.

From some of the oldest Sangiovese vineyards comes Colore every year, the maximum expression of Bibi Graetz' dream. The barren, sandy soils at high altitudes create the perfect terroir for a wine that can tell the true story of Tuscany and its inhabitants. The grapes for Colore were selected from vineyards in Lamole, Vincigliata and Siena. Each vineyard was harvested up to eight times in order to achieve the optimum ripening time for as many grapes as possible. Each parcel is matured separately in barriques for almost two years before the final blend is decided. Only the best Sangiovese barriques from each vintage become Colore. SUPERIORE.DE

The grapes of UnoPerUno come from the cru vineyards Arborina in La Morra, Cannubi in Barolo, Pernanno in Castiglione Falletto, Sarmassa in Barolo and Cerretta in Serralunga d'Alba and are individually destemmed. As a result of this intensive manual work, only 1,300 bottles of this exceptional wine are sold in well-stocked specialist shops, and only in the best vintages. Due to the manual destemming, no green overtones of the stems get into the mash, making the tannins silkier and creamier than in the conventional process. The result is something to be savoured: UnoPerUno is of high fruit intensity, has an incredible depth and structure and is a benchmark of the appellation every year in its purity and clarity on the nose and palate.
